We certainly need moderate Republicans, and I thought of voting for Susan Collins because I thought of her as one of the few moderate Republicans left in the Senate. However, she voted against reducing interest on student loans and, unlike Sen. Angus King, voted against allowing the Senate to control campaign finance spending.

Hence, I’ve decided to vote for Shenna Bellows for the U.S. Senate. Although she is running on the Democratic ticket, I’ve heard her speak, and she thinks for herself.

I know many people don’t vote. They think their vote doesn’t matter because money buys elections and how the Senate votes.

However, this is an instance where voting matters. I urge anyone who wants us to be able to control the money spent on campaigns and lobbying to vote for Bellows.
